Duties of the Board of Directors |
|
|
|
Duties &
responsibilities |
-
The members of
the Board of Directors have been elected by the membership to represent
the membership in directing the management of the Cooperative.
-
The Board of
Directors has as one of its major responsibilities the continued
corporate existence of the Cooperative. In carrying out this
responsibility, the Board sets the direction for the Cooperative, sees
that resources are available, provides the necessary guidelines through
policy to management and establishes the necessary controls to assure
that satisfactory results are achieved and information is provided for
Board planning.
-
The Board
achieves results through the General Manager & CEO. The General Manager
& CEO serves as the chief resource person to the Board, providing
information, recommendations and assistance to the Board to enable the
Board to fulfill its responsibility to the membership of the
Cooperative.
-
The Board and
General Manager & CEO make up the top management team of the
Cooperative, and as such maintain a close working relationship, giving
and receiving information to assure decisions affecting the Cooperative
are made in a timely manner and move the Cooperative in a positive
direction toward achieving its objectives.

To become a board
member: |
- The upcoming
Nominating/Member Meetings are the first step to becoming a member of
the board. Once a member has been nominated either through a nomination
or a petition, then the member’s name is placed on the ballot at Annual
Meeting and voted on by the members attending the meeting.
